The G41T-AD V1.0 (often found in Acer or ECS systems) is a Micro-ATX motherboard built on the Intel G41 chipset. While a specific standalone manual for version 1.0 can be difficult to find directly on official sites, it is part of the broader ECS G41T series, and manuals for closely related models like the G41T-M7 or G41T-R3 provide near-identical technical guidance. Key Specifications
CPU Support: Compatible with LGA 775 socket processors, including Intel Core 2 Quad, Core 2 Duo, Pentium, and Celeron series.
Memory: Supports up to 8GB of DDR3 RAM across two DIMM slots, typically at speeds of 800/1066/1333 (OC) MHz.
Expansion: Includes one PCI Express x16 slot for a discrete graphics card and typically one PCI Express x1 and one legacy PCI slot.
Storage: Equipped with SATA 3.0 Gbps connectors (SATA II) and often a legacy IDE connector.
Graphics: Features integrated Intel GMA X4500 graphics with a VGA (D-Sub) output. Manual & Setup Insights
The manual is essential for identifying the Front Panel Header pinout, which is a common point of confusion for this board. A standard configuration for this series is as follows: Pin 1 & 3: Hard Drive Activity LED. Pin 2 & 4: Power/Sleep LED. Pin 5 & 7: Reset Switch. Pin 6 & 8: Power Switch. The G41T-AD V1.0 is an OEM motherboard manufactured by ECS (Elitegroup) and is commonly found in Acer Aspire (e.g., X1900, X1920) and eMachines (e.g., EL1850, EL1852G) desktop systems. Since it is a proprietary board for pre-built PCs, it often lacks a traditional retail manual, but it follows the general design of the ECS G41T-M series. Core Specifications Form Factor: DTX (203 mm x 244 mm) or Micro-ATX. Chipset: Intel G41 (North Bridge) and ICH7 (South Bridge).
CPU Support: LGA 775 socket supporting Intel Core 2 Quad, Core 2 Duo, Pentium Dual-Core, and Celeron processors with FSB speeds of 800/1066/1333 MHz. Memory: Two 240-pin DIMM slots supporting DDR3 RAM.
Max Capacity: Often limited to 4GB total (2GB per slot) by the chipset, though some documentation indicates support up to 8GB. Speeds: DDR3 800/1066/1333 MHz.
Graphics: Integrated Intel Graphics Media Accelerator (GMA) X4500. Storage: 2x SATA II (3.0 Gb/s) ports. Expansion & I/O Slots: 1x PCIe x16 (for graphics) and 1x PCIe x1.
Rear Ports: VGA, 4x USB 2.0 (standard), PS/2 Keyboard/Mouse, RJ-45 (Gigabit LAN), and 3-jack Audio (Realtek ALC662).
Power: 24-pin ATX main power and 4-pin ATX 12V CPU power connectors. Front Panel Header (F_PANEL)
While proprietary, the pin layout typically follows the ECS G41T-M7 Standard: Pins 1-3: Hard Disk (HDD) Activity LED Pins 2-4: Power LED Pins 5-7: Reset Switch Pins 6-8: Power Switch Technical Documentation Resources

The G41T-AD V1.0 motherboard (often manufactured by ECS (Elitegroup) for Acer and eMachines systems) is a classic LGA 775 platform based on the Intel G41 chipset. Core Technical Specifications
Processor Support: Supports Intel LGA 775 socket CPUs, including Core 2 Quad, Core 2 Duo, Pentium Dual-Core, and Celeron processors.
Front Side Bus (FSB): Supports speeds of 800, 1066, and 1333 MHz.
Memory: Features 2 DDR3 slots, typically supporting up to 8GB of total system memory at speeds of 800, 1066, or 1333 MHz (PC3-10600). Some earlier documentation or specific OEM versions may list a max of 4GB.
Expansion Slots: Includes 1x PCIe x16 for dedicated graphics and 1x PCIe x1 for other expansion cards.
Storage: Features SATA 3.0 Gbps connectors for hard drives and SSDs. Rear Panel Connectivity Video: 1x VGA port for integrated Intel GMA X4500 graphics.
USB: 4x USB 2.0 ports (plus internal headers for additional ports). Networking: 1x RJ-45 LAN port (Gigabit Ethernet).
